How Bifold Doors Improve Energy Efficiency
Homeowners are increasingly aware that modern bifold doors considerably boost energy conservation in household environments. Such doors are built with superior insulation methods, commonly including multi-chamber frame systems and energy-efficient glass. This construction limits heat loss, working to preserve a stable interior temperature year-round.
During colder periods, bifold doors prevent drafts, decreasing the demand for excessive heating. On the other hand, in the warmer months, they help to keep cool air inside, reducing dependence on air conditioning. In addition, the generous glass panels allow natural light to flood in, which can minimise the requirement for artificial lighting during the day.
The outcome is a more energy-efficient home that not only reduces utility bills but also promotes a smaller carbon footprint. Flexible Styles for Bifold Doors
Bifold doors provide an array of versatile designs that work well with diverse architectural styles and personal tastes. Coming in materials including wood, aluminum, and uPVC, these doors can be customized to match contemporary and classic aesthetic styles. Homeowners are able to select from a range of finishes, colors, and configurations, enabling them to create a smooth and harmonious link between indoor and outdoor living areas.
The flexibility of bifold doors goes beyond their appearance. They can be installed in various locations, including patios, living rooms, or dining spaces, enhancing natural light and views. Additionally, bifold doors can be customized regarding size and number of panels, enabling generous openings that meet specific preferences. This versatility has made bifold doors a favored option in contemporary residences, where design and practicality must intersect harmoniously. Overall, their flexible designs support both aesthetic appeal and practical use in domestic settings.

Do Bifold Doors Work Well in Every Climate?
Bifold doors may be appropriate for diverse climate conditions, so long as they feature proper insulation and are made from weather-resistant materials. However, extreme weather conditions may necessitate additional considerations for durability and energy efficiency.
In What Ways Do Bifold Doors Boost Security Features?
Bifold doors enhance security features via robust locking mechanisms, fortified frames, and laminated glass alternatives. These components discourage unwanted intrusion while giving homeowners confidence, ensuring a balance between aesthetic appeal and safety.
What Upkeep Do Bifold Doors Need?
Bifold doors need routine cleaning of tracks and frames, periodic lubrication of copyrights, and inspection for weather stripping integrity. Keeping proper alignment and resolving any signs of wear ensures lasting functionality and aesthetic appeal.
Can Bifold Doors Be Installed in Existing Openings?
Bifold doors are certainly capable of being fitted into existing openings, as long as the structural framework is able to bear their weight. Proper measurements and adjustments guarantee a seamless fit, improving both the practicality and visual appeal of the space.
What Are the Common Costs Involved With Bifold Doors?
The typical costs associated with bifold doors span from $1,000 to $5,000, depending on installation complexity, materials, and size. Premium materials and custom configurations can significantly raise the total cost, influencing financial planning for the project.
